The image displays the Old Fire Station Tower in Hrodna, Belarus, located at the intersection of Zamkavaya Street and Karl Marx Street. The scene is captured under a bright blue sky with scattered cirrus clouds. In the foreground and central-right, a tall, multi-tiered brick tower, constructed from light yellow bricks, rises prominently. It features various window types, including a circular window and several rectangular arched windows. The tower culminates in an observation deck surrounded by a dark red wooden railing, topped with a dark red octagonal roof and a weather vane finial. To the left and slightly behind the tower, a two-story building with a light cream-colored facade is visible. This building has a steeply pitched roof covered in red tiles, featuring multiple dormer windows and several white-capped chimneys. A small iron-railed balcony extends from a second-story window on the left side of the building. Numerous rectangular windows are distributed across its facade.
